26-27 Assistant Principal, Elementary (Scharbauer)

Not Disclosed•Full-TimeOn-site

location_onWest Front Street, McCoy, Midland, Midland County, Texas, 79701, United States

Apply Now

About the Role

The Elementary Assistant Principal serves as a vital partner to the Principal and the Executive Director of Teaching & Learning, dedicated to fostering a positive, high-performing school culture. This role is designed to support the implementation of the MISD curriculum, ensure instructional excellence, and maintain a safe, nurturing environment for students and staff. The Assistant Principal acts as a bridge between administration, faculty, families, and the community, driving school improvement initiatives and upholding the district's commitment to equity and student success.

Day in the Life

Your day will be dynamic, balancing instructional leadership with operational management. You will conduct classroom observations and engage in professional conferences with teachers to support their growth and align with T-TESS standards. A significant portion of your time will be spent cultivating school climate by facilitating team building, resolving conflicts, and promoting positive student behavior across hallways, cafeterias, and classrooms.

You will also play a key role in personnel development, assisting with the recruitment, mentoring, and assessment of new hires. From coordinating faculty meetings to managing campus schedules and safety drills, you will ensure the school runs smoothly while maximizing instructional time. Additionally, you will represent the school at PTA meetings and district board sessions, strengthening home-school connections and community relations.

Key Responsibilities

  • check_circleInterpret curriculum guides and assist in program implementation
  • check_circleConduct classroom observations and teacher conferences
  • check_circlePromote positive student learning environment and staff morale
  • check_circleAssist in planning and preparation of the school budget
  • check_circleAssist in teacher assessment to determine staff development needs
  • check_circleImplement district discipline management plan
  • check_circleSupervise pupils in campus areas such as halls and cafeteria
  • check_circleAttend PTA meetings and participate in public relations activities
  • check_circleCoordinate routine maintenance requests and building inspections
  • check_circleDevelop agendas and conduct faculty meetings

Requirements

  • verifiedMaster's degree from an accredited college or university
  • verifiedValid Mid-Management or Principal Certificate
  • verifiedCertified in the Texas Teacher Evaluation and Support System (T-TESS)
  • verifiedPass Bilingual or ESL exam through the Texas Education Agency
  • verifiedMinimum of three years successful teaching experience
